Due diligence for buyers in Calbugos should cover: lot title status and encumbrances, flood zone classification per NAMRIA hazard maps, and proximity to Villaba's commercial district for resale liquidity. single-family homes, townhouses, and affordable condominiums are the typical property formats here.

High flood risk in Villaba is a serious consideration for buyers in Calbugos. During typhoon season, significant flooding can occur. Key questions to ask before buying: Which months does this street flood? What is the average water depth? Has interior flooding ever occurred? How long does water typically take to recede?

Is Calbugos, Villaba a good investment for OFWs?
OFW investors in Calbugos typically target house-and-lot or townhouse units for rental or family use. Villaba's established growth profile determines rental demand: steady local rental demand from workers and families. Pag-IBIG housing loans are available for eligible properties.
What is the rental yield potential in Calbugos?
Rental yields in Calbugos depend on property type, condition, and tenant demand in Villaba. Established markets yield a steady 4–6% gross from local family and worker tenants. Verify current rental comparables with a local broker before projecting returns.
